+// Simon's Watchdog code from http://mbed.org/forum/mbed/topic/508/
+class Watchdog {
+public:
+// Load timeout value in watchdog timer and enable
+    void kick(float s) {
+        LPC_WDT->WDCLKSEL = 0x1;                // Set CLK src to PCLK
+        uint32_t clk = SystemCoreClock / 16;    // WD has a fixed /4 prescaler, PCLK default is /4
+        LPC_WDT->WDTC = s * (float)clk;
+        LPC_WDT->WDMOD = 0x3;                   // Enabled and Reset
+        kick();
+    }
+// "kick" or "feed" the dog - reset the watchdog timer
+// by writing this required bit pattern
+    void kick() {
+        LPC_WDT->WDFEED = 0xAA;
+        LPC_WDT->WDFEED = 0x55;
+    }
+};
+ 
+Watchdog wdt;   // Set up the watchdog timer
